The Logs market within the context of Forestry is a sector of the industry that involves the harvesting, processing, and sale of timber. Logs are typically harvested from forests and then transported to sawmills, where they are cut into lumber and other wood products. Logs are also used for fuel, construction, and other industrial purposes. The Logs market is an important part of the forestry industry, as it provides a source of income for many rural communities. The Logs market is highly competitive, with many companies vying for market share. Companies in the Logs market include Weyerhaeuser, International Paper, Georgia-Pacific, West Fraser Timber, and Rayonier. These companies are involved in the harvesting, processing, and sale of timber, as well as the production of wood products.
